What is Synlait Milk Cash And Cash Equivalents?

Synlait Milk's quarterly cash and cash equivalents declined from Jan. 2023 (A$11.44 Mil) to Jul. 2023 (A$8.58 Mil) but then increased from Jul. 2023 (A$8.58 Mil) to Jan. 2024 (A$28.36 Mil).

Synlait Milk's annual cash and cash equivalents declined from Jul. 2021 (A$15.08 Mil) to Jul. 2022 (A$13.10 Mil) and declined from Jul. 2022 (A$13.10 Mil) to Jul. 2023 (A$8.58 Mil).

Cash and cash equivalents are the most liquid assets on the balance sheet. Cash equivalents are assets that are readily convertible into cash, such as money market holdings, short-term government bonds or Treasury bills, marketable securities and commercial paper.


Synlait Milk  (ASX:SM1) Cash And Cash Equivalents Explanation

A high number means either:

1) The company has competitive advantage generating lots of cash

2) Just sold a business or bonds (not necessarily good)

A low stockpile of cash usually means poor to mediocre economics.

There are 3 ways to create large cash reserve.

1) Sell new bonds or equity to public

2) Sell business or asset

3) It has an ongoing business generating more cash than it burns (usually means durable competitive advantage)

When a company is suffering a short term problem, Buffett looks at cash or marketable securities to see whether it has the financial strength to ride it out.

Important: Lots of cash and marketable securities + little debt = good chance that the business will sail on through tough times.

Test to see what is creating cash by looking at past 7 yrs of balance sheets. This will reveal how the cash was created.

Synlait Milk Ltd is a dairy processing company that benefits from a differentiated milk supply and unique operating environment in New Zealand. The business operates within one industry that includes the manufacture of milk powder and its related products, liquid milk, cheese, and butter. The company's success is largely due to its core infant nutrition business. Some of its key products include infant nutritional powders, whole milk powders, skim milk powders, anhydrous milk fat, and lactoferrin. The company is largely export-focused with China as its largest export market. The acquisition of two cheese companies resulted in an instant increase in the cheese segment and a more diversified earnings base.
